College of Charleston: Chemistry Ranking 2024

College of CharlestonRanked
523
in the USA
College of Charleston is a medium-sized public college offering numerous disciplines along with chemistry programs and located in Charleston, South Carolina. The college is operating since 1770 and is currently offering bachelor's degrees in 2 chemistry programs.

College of Charleston is very expensive: depending on the program, tuition is around $38,000 a year. If you are seeking a cheaper alternative, check Affordable Colleges in South Carolina listing.

According to recent studies, College of Charleston area is dangerous; the school is reported to have a very bad rating for on-campus security.

Based on 68 evaluation factors, College of Charleston chemistry program ranks #523 Chemistry School (out of 1532; top 35%) in USA and #7 Chemistry School in South Carolina. Major competing chemistry schools for this school are Emory University in Atlanta and Georgia Institute of Technology in Atlanta.
